A garantia de chave é um processo criptográfico que envolve o armazenamento de chaves de criptografia por um terceiro confiável, conhecido como agente de garantia. O objetivo principal do depósito de chave é fornecer um mecanismo para que partes autorizadas acessem dados ou comunicações criptografadas, caso o titular da chave original fique indisponível ou perca o acesso à sua chave de criptografia. Este sistema garante a acessibilidade e continuidade dos dados em situações críticas, especialmente no contexto da comunicação digital e segurança de dados.
A história da origem do depósito de chaves e a primeira menção dele.
O conceito de garantia de chave remonta aos primórdios da criptografia moderna no final do século XX. A ideia surgiu como resposta à crescente importância das comunicações seguras e à necessidade de impedir o acesso não autorizado a informações sensíveis. Uma das primeiras menções ao depósito de chaves remonta à proposta do chip Clipper no início da década de 1990 pelo governo dos EUA.
O chip Clipper era um microchip de criptografia destinado ao uso em dispositivos de telecomunicações e incorporava um mecanismo de garantia de chave. O governo dos EUA pretendia permitir que as agências responsáveis pela aplicação da lei acedessem a comunicações encriptadas quando necessário para combater potenciais atividades criminosas. No entanto, a proposta do chip Clipper enfrentou controvérsia significativa, com preocupações levantadas sobre privacidade, segurança e o potencial de abuso das chaves garantidas.
Informações detalhadas sobre o depósito de chaves. Expandindo o tópico Garantia de chave.
A garantia da chave envolve três entidades principais: o proprietário da chave, o destinatário (ou destinatário pretendido) dos dados criptografados e o agente de garantia confiável. Quando o proprietário da chave criptografa dados ou mensagens confidenciais, a chave de criptografia é dividida em duas partes: uma parte permanece com o proprietário da chave, enquanto a outra parte é armazenada com segurança pelo agente de garantia. Em alguns casos, um terceiro componente conhecido como chave dividida ou chave de recuperação também pode ser gerado, com cada componente mantido separadamente pelo proprietário da chave e pelo agente de garantia.
O processo de descriptografia normalmente requer colaboração entre o proprietário da chave e o agente de garantia. Se o proprietário da chave ficar indisponível ou perder o acesso à sua chave, o agente de custódia pode liberar a parte armazenada da chave para permitir a descriptografia de dados pelo destinatário autorizado. Este mecanismo é particularmente valioso para cenários como investigações policiais, recuperação de dados de indivíduos falecidos ou continuidade de negócios em caso de perda de chave.
A estrutura interna do depósito da chave. Como funciona o depósito de chaves.
A estrutura interna do depósito de chaves envolve vários componentes principais:
-
Algoritmo de criptografia: O algoritmo usado para criptografar os dados ou a comunicação, gerando a chave de criptografia que será dividida e garantida.
-
Geração de Chave: quando um usuário gera uma chave de criptografia para proteger seus dados ou comunicação, o sistema de garantia de chave divide automaticamente a chave em vários componentes.
-
Agente de Custódia: o terceiro confiável responsável por armazenar com segurança uma parte da chave de criptografia. Esta entidade deve seguir protocolos de segurança rígidos para evitar o acesso não autorizado às chaves garantidas.
-
Proprietário da chave: O indivíduo ou entidade que possui a chave de criptografia e decide participar do sistema de garantia de chave.
-
Destinatário: A parte autorizada que pode receber a chave garantida do agente de garantia em circunstâncias específicas.
O processo típico de garantia de chave funciona da seguinte forma:
-
Geração de chave: O proprietário da chave gera uma chave de criptografia usando o algoritmo de criptografia escolhido.
-
Divisão de chave: O sistema de garantia de chave divide a chave de criptografia em vários componentes, distribuindo-os entre o proprietário da chave e o agente de garantia.
-
Criptografia de dados: O proprietário da chave usa sua parte da chave para criptografar dados ou comunicações confidenciais.
-
Armazenamento de chaves sob custódia: O agente de custódia armazena com segurança sua parte da chave.
-
Recuperação de chave: Em certas situações, o destinatário autorizado pode solicitar a chave garantida ao agente de garantia para descriptografar os dados ou a comunicação.
Análise das principais características do Key escrow.
O depósito de chaves oferece vários recursos importantes que o tornam valioso em contextos específicos:
-
Acessibilidade de dados: o depósito da chave garante que os dados criptografados ainda possam ser acessados mesmo se o proprietário original da chave ficar indisponível, perder a chave ou falecer.
-
Riscos de segurança: Ao confiar ao agente de custódia uma parte da chave, o depósito da chave introduz riscos potenciais de segurança. Se os sistemas do agente de custódia forem comprometidos, poderá ocorrer acesso não autorizado a informações confidenciais.
-
Preocupações legais e éticas: O depósito principal levanta debates sobre a privacidade e a extensão do acesso do governo às comunicações privadas. Equilibrar as necessidades de aplicação da lei e os direitos individuais continua a ser uma questão complexa.
-
Continuidade de Negócios: para as organizações, o depósito de chaves fornece um plano de backup para manter operações críticas em caso de perda de chaves ou rotatividade de funcionários.
Tipos de garantia de chave
O depósito de chaves pode ser classificado em vários tipos com base nas partes envolvidas e no caso de uso. Os dois tipos principais de garantia de chave são:
-
Garantia de chave única: neste tipo, um único agente de garantia detém uma parte da chave de criptografia e o destinatário autorizado pode solicitar a chave garantida diretamente do agente de garantia quando necessário.
-
Garantia de chave dupla: O depósito de chave dupla envolve dois agentes de depósito separados, cada um contendo uma parte da chave de criptografia. Para recuperar os dados, ambos os agentes de custódia devem cooperar e fornecer as suas partes da chave.
Abaixo está uma tabela de comparação destacando as diferenças entre o depósito de chave única e o depósito de chave dupla:
Aspecto | Garantia de chave única | Garantia de chave dupla |
---|---|---|
Número de agentes de custódia | Um | Dois |
Complexidade | Mais baixo | Mais alto |
Processo de recuperação de chave | Mais simples | Requer cooperação entre agentes |
Risco de segurança | Ponto único de falha (o agente de garantia) | Requer o compromisso de ambos os agentes |
Maneiras de usar o depósito de chave:
-
Aplicação da lei: O depósito de chaves pode permitir o acesso legal a comunicações criptografadas para agências de aplicação da lei durante investigações, sujeito à autorização legal adequada.
-
Recuperação de dados: o depósito de chaves pode facilitar a recuperação de dados para organizações ou indivíduos que perderam acesso às suas chaves de criptografia.
-
Sistemas legados: Em situações em que métodos de criptografia antigos são usados, o depósito de chaves pode ser empregado para garantir compatibilidade com versões anteriores e acessibilidade aos dados.
Problemas e soluções:
-
Preocupações com segurança: O armazenamento de chaves garantidas apresenta possíveis vulnerabilidades de segurança. A implementação de criptografia robusta, controles de acesso e auditorias regulares de segurança pode mitigar esses riscos.
-
Implicações de privacidade: O depósito da chave levanta preocupações sobre a privacidade do usuário. A implementação de políticas e quadros jurídicos rigorosos para o acesso a chaves garantidas pode resolver estes problemas.
-
Confiabilidade do agente de custódia: A confiabilidade e confiabilidade do agente de custódia são críticas. A seleção de um fornecedor de garantia respeitável e competente é vital para o sucesso do sistema.
Principais características e outras comparações com termos semelhantes em forma de tabelas e listas.
Característica | Garantia de chave | Agente de recuperação de chave |
---|---|---|
Propósito | Armazenamento e backup seguro de chaves | Facilite a recuperação de chaves para os usuários |
Envolve | Proprietário da chave e agente(s) de garantia | Proprietário da chave e agente dedicado |
Autorização para acesso chave | Geralmente requer cooperação | Autorizado pelo proprietário da chave |
Foco | Segurança e acessibilidade de dados | Recuperação de chaves em casos de emergência |
Casos de uso | Criptografia e recuperação de dados | Senhas esquecidas, chaves perdidas |
À medida que a tecnologia evolui e surgem novos métodos de criptografia, o conceito de garantia de chave pode continuar a evoluir para atender às novas necessidades dos usuários e das organizações. Algumas perspectivas e tecnologias futuras potenciais relacionadas ao depósito principal incluem:
-
Garantia de chave multifatorial: Incorporação de mecanismos de autenticação multifatorial para aumentar a segurança dos sistemas de garantia de chaves.
-
Garantia baseada em Blockchain: Explorando o uso da tecnologia blockchain para criar sistemas de garantia descentralizados e à prova de falsificação.
-
Garantia de chave segura quântica: Desenvolvimento de métodos de garantia importantes que sejam resistentes a ataques de computação quântica para garantir segurança a longo prazo.
Como os servidores proxy podem ser usados ou associados ao depósito de chaves.
Os servidores proxy desempenham um papel crucial na facilitação da comunicação segura e anônima entre usuários e sites. Quando usados em conjunto com o depósito de chaves, os servidores proxy podem fornecer uma camada adicional de segurança e privacidade. Aqui estão algumas maneiras pelas quais os servidores proxy podem ser associados ao depósito de chaves:
-
Anonimato aprimorado: Os servidores proxy podem ser usados para ocultar os endereços IP reais dos usuários, tornando mais difícil para possíveis invasores atingirem o proprietário da chave e o agente de garantia.
-
Transferência segura de dados: Os servidores proxy podem criptografar os dados entre o usuário e o servidor, adicionando uma camada extra de proteção à comunicação.
-
Recuperação de chave via proxy: Em determinados cenários, o destinatário autorizado pode solicitar a chave garantida por meio de um servidor proxy, garantindo a comunicação segura entre o destinatário e o agente de garantia.
Links Relacionados
Para obter mais informações sobre o depósito de chaves, você pode consultar os seguintes recursos:
- Instituto Nacional de Padrões e Tecnologia (NIST) – Informações importantes sobre garantia
- Electronic Frontier Foundation (EFF) – Arquivo Clipper Chip
Nota: As informações fornecidas neste artigo são apenas para fins educacionais. Os leitores são incentivados a pesquisar mais e consultar especialistas para obter uma compreensão abrangente do depósito principal e suas implicações.